在 Google Play 上启用 Android 订阅免费试用

Sun*_*kas 6 android in-app-purchase android-inapp-purchase google-play-console

我在获取应用内订阅的免费试用时遇到问题。订阅正在运行,但每次我测试时(即使使用新设备/谷歌帐户),它都会显示为“从今天开始”(见下图,文本为瑞典语)。

\n

我假设您不需要任何代码,并且所有内容都可以在 Google Play Console 中设置。

\n

我的结构如下“我的应用程序”>“产品”>“订阅”:

\n
- Base subscription (Per month, renewed automatically)\n   - Offer - Every month (renews automatically)\n     Phases:\n     - Free trial (duration = 1 month)\n
Run Code Online (Sandbox Code Playgroud)\n

优惠页面如下所示:

\n

在此输入图像描述

\n

并且阶段仅包含一项:

\n

在此输入图像描述

\n

在全新设备上测试时的图像:\n在此输入图像描述

\n

将“Fr\xc3\xa5n och med idag”=>“从今天开始”翻译成英语。

\n

我究竟做错了什么?查看 Stackoverflow 帖子,所有帖子都与如何以编程方式获取免费试用可用性状态相关,我对此不感兴趣。我假设本机 Google 对话框直接从 Google Play 服务器获取此信息。

\n

Sun*_*kas 8

事实证明,谷歌上个月刚刚宣布了一项新的订阅计划。

我不得不“迁移”免费试用优惠以使其向后兼容。单击报价行上的三个点,然后“迁移”以使其与旧的遗留方法一起使用。